Instructions
Dough:
In a mixing bowl of a Stand Mixer, dissolve the Yeast with Water and Sugar.
Add the Oil and Mix.
Add the Flour and Cornmeal
Mix for 4 minutes at Medium Speed, until dough is smooth and pliable. (if mixing by hand, knead 7-8 minutes)
Reduce Speed to Low and mix for additional 2 minutes
Add the 1 tsp of Olive Oil to a large bowl. Place dough ball into the bowl and turn to coat completely with oil. Cover with plastic wrap or a slightly dampened kitchen towel.
Let dough rise 2 HOURS in a warm environment
*Notes*
**I turn my oven to the lowest temperature, turn off the heat, and place the Bowl in the oven to rise.
**If not using the dough right away, you can place it in the refrigerator and allow it to slowly rise overnight. Be sure to remove the dough from the refrigerator at least an hour before you are ready to use it.
Sauce: (prepare while dough is rising)
Melt Butter in a medium sized saucepan over medium heat. Add the onion and cook, stirring occasionally, until slightly golden, about 5 minutes.
Add the Garlic, Oregano, Red Pepper Flakes, Salt, and Pepper. Cook just until aromatic, about 30 seconds.
Add the Red Wine, allow to simmer and the wine to reduce, about 2 minutes.
Stir in the Sugar and Tomatoes, Increase the heat to Medium High to return to a Simmer.
Once simmering, lower heat to Medium low (making sure to maintain a gentle simmer) and allow to cook for 25-30 minutes… until reduced to about 1 ¼ Cup.
Off heat, stir in Basil, Oil, and Parmesan Cheese.
Taste and Adjust Seasoning
To Assemble and Cook Pizza:
Preheat oven to 450 degrees.
Grease Cast Iron Skillet, or pan you are using, well with Oil.
Place the dough on a dry work surface and roll/stretch out into a 13’’ circle, about ¼’’ thick. Transfer dough to the pan, lightly pressing the dough into the pan and pressing the dough up the sides. If dough resists, allow it to rest 5 minutes and try again.
“Dock the dough with a fork a few times.
Lay the Slices of Mozzarella on top of the dough, overlapping to completely cover the bottom. Next, layer Pepperoni, followed by Sauteed Vegetables. Sprinkle browned Sausage overtop. Spoon the cooled sauce over, completely covering Pizza toppings. Sprinkle with Freshly grated Parmesan.
Cook Pizza on the Stovetop FIRST, over HIGH HEAT, for 3-4 minutes to heat up the pan.
Transfer the Pizza to the preheated oven to finish cooking, about 18-20 minutes.
Allow the Pizza to rest for 5 minutes before removing, cutting, and serving.
